The density of steel is 7,850 kilograms per cubic meter (kg/m 3). This value remains constant, regardless of the size of the steel bar. Ρу = 0.0061654 * d2, (kg/m), where d is the circle diameter in mm. For example, the weight of a 16mm steel bar per meter is approximately 1.58 kg/m.
